**Onboarding — Fabrikit Test-Data Factory**

On-call: Fabrikit seeds the staging database nightly. If seeding fails, check the factory registry for stale trait definitions first; that's the cause 90% of the time. Never run factories against production. To unseal the staging credentials bundle, use the passphrase below.

vault phrase of kawep-tahog = ulaix-briath

**Q: Why are the font files committed directly into the repo instead of fetched at build time?**

A: The Brindlecote design system requires the Maravel typeface family, which is licensed to Osthaven Labs for embedded redistribution only. Fetching at build time would violate the license and break reproducible builds. When reviewing, confirm the checksum manifest in `fonts/VENDORED.md` matches the committed binaries. Licensing questions should go to the address below.

escalation mailbox, hadug-bajog: sormir@norvalabs.internal

14:22 — The Pellwright broker upgrade to 5.x completed on the primary cluster, but plugins compiled against the 4.x wire format began failing handshake negotiation. Plugin authors should note that the compatibility shim was not yet enabled at this point; it went live at 14:40. Affected connections during this window logged a protocol-mismatch error carrying the deploy token recorded below.

pipeline stamp: htk6_35e0c9

Handover: Shrinkray CLI

For review: Shrinkray handles batch image resizing across our asset buckets. I finished the concurrency rework; worker pools now scale with input count. Outstanding items are noted inline as TODOs. Tests pass locally and in CI. The runtime settings the tool currently ships with are shown below.

settings of fafog-haduf:
ZORIX_PIN=4648
ZORIX_METRICS_HOST=metrics.zorix.paliqsys.corp
ZORIX_LOG_LEVEL=info
ZORIX_TENANT=druix

## Tuning

Glimmerscope samples GPU allocations on a timer, so the knobs here trade overhead for resolution. Crank the sample rate up and you'll catch short-lived spikes, but expect a few percent hit on kernel throughput; dial it down for production runs. The ring buffer size also matters more than you'd think on long traces. If you only change one thing, change the sample interval. Defaults are listed below.

tuning table, kajog-kawef:
PRIORITIES = {
    "kelox": 870,
    "kasix": 89,
    "eliax": 988,
}